Chapter 439



The next day, sunlight streamed into the room, shining on Quinn's pale face. Her eyelashes trembled, and she slowly opened her eyes, but the cold sunlight dazzled her. She raised her hand to shield her eyes from the light. After a moment, Quinn sat up in bed. She turned her head and saw a note paper on the bedside table. She picked it up and read it silently for a while before sticking it back.

She heard the puppies barking outside, and she hurriedly got out of bed and ran out of the bedroom. When she came out, she froze.

Alexander was facing away from her, squatting on the ground, feeding the two puppies. She wasn't entirely sure if it was Alexander, as she could only see his back. Quinn stood there for a moment before slowly approaching the man, coming to his side and tilting her head to get a look. She saw his familiar profile.

Alexander seemed to sense her presence and looked up at Quinn. Quinn blinked and then turned her gaze around, taking in all the unfamiliar surroundings before looking back at Alexander. Alexander stood up, tilting his head, and stared at her intently as if waiting for something.

After a while, Quinn raised her hand and gestured. "Why are we here?" Alexander looked at her moving fingers with a momentary daze in his expression.

Quinn saw him distracted and reached out to pull his sleeve. Alexander snapped back to attention and said in a deep voice, "Come and look at these two dogs."

She glanced at the dogs on the ground again, but his words didn't seem convincing.

Alexander's finger landed on her face as he asked, "Do you remember anything?"

Quinn shook her head. Other than knowing that she was sick, she couldn't remember anything, specifically how she ended up here.

Alexander furrowed his brow slightly. He bent down and picked up the two dogs that were still eating on the ground, then casually stuffed them into a cage. Then he took hold of Quinn's hand and said, "Since you're awake, let's go."

Quinn was now bewildered. Besides following Alexander, she didn't know what else to do.

Alexander put the cage in the car, lifted his chin, and gestured for her to get in.

Quinn got into the car, fastened her seatbelt with confusion, and followed him back to Regal Riverside.

Alexander let the dogs out and took out a bag of dog food from the storeroom, refilling the dogs' food bowls.

Then, he handed two notebooks to Quinn.

Quinn began flipping through them. They contained records of what had happened during this period of time, as well as her work at Kennedy Enterprise. However, quite a few of the pages had been torn off.

After flipping through them quickly a couple of times, she didn't find any useful information.

Quinn set the notebooks down and gestured to him, asking, "How did these get torn off?"

Alexander replied seriously, "You tore them off yourself. How am I supposed to know?"

Quinn furrowed her brows even more. Why would she tear these off?

Just then, Soren arrived. He came back with a bunch of groceries, and the first thing he did upon seeing Quinn was greet her.

He habitually asked her, "Quinn, do you remember me today?"

Quinn nodded and said she remembered him.

What felt strange was that she indeed did remember him, but only his name and his job.

Everything else was a blur.

This was the first time she had gotten this kind of illness, and Quinn didn't know why it was happening. Maybe... it was just like this?
